Lonely, ignored, different, and unaccepted, Crooks is a segregated African American character in the fictional novella, Of Mice and Men, written by John Steinbeck. Crooks is the considered the lower class on the farm; he is also isolated from most of his co-workers. Web27 apr. 2024 · He is immediately defensive of his space. He isn’t allowed in the other men’s bunk house, so he doesn’t like anyone in his, bothering him. What do we learn about Crooks’s family life? Crooks was born in California on a chicken ranch. He grew up in a white neighborhood and had white friends, although is father didn’t like that.
